For National Black History Month, we bring you this lauded drama adapted from Lorraine Hansberry’s immortal play of the same name (the first play by a black woman to be performed on Broadway). The Youngers, an African-American family living together in a cramped Chicago apartment, await a life-insurance check following the death of their patriarch. Opinions vary – and tensions arise – over what to do with the money. Vividly rendering Hansberry’s sharp observations on generational conflict and housing discrimination, director Daniel Petrie’s film captures the high stakes, shifting currents, and varieties of experience within black life in midcentury America. Starring Sidney Poitier and Ruby Dee. (1961, PG, 128 mins)
